Behavioral interventions to reduce nickel exposure in a nickel processing plant
Krassi Rumchev1, Helen Brown1, Amanda Wheeler1
1a School of Public Health , Curtin University , Perth , Australia.
Journal of Occupational and Environmental Hygiene
|June 23, 2017
Summary
Educational interventions significantly reduced nickel exposure in Indonesian smelter workers by improving hygiene behaviors. This study highlights the effectiveness of targeted education in mitigating occupational health risks associated with nickel.
Area of Science:
- Occupational Health
- Environmental Science
- Toxicology
Background:
- Nickel is essential in many industries but poses significant health risks, including respiratory illnesses, allergies, and cancer, from occupational exposure.
- Controlling and reducing nickel exposure in workplaces is crucial due to its widespread industrial use and associated health hazards.
- Existing evidence necessitates strategies to mitigate nickel exposure risks in occupational settings.
Purpose of the Study:
- To assess the effectiveness of educational interventions in reducing nickel exposure among Indonesian nickel smelter workers.
- To evaluate the impact of different educational approaches (booklet, presentation, personal feedback) on personal nickel exposure levels.
- To determine if improved hygiene behaviors, prompted by education, can lead to measurable reductions in nickel biomarkers.
Main Methods:
- A randomized controlled study involving 99 Indonesian nickel smelter workers assigned to three groups.
- Interventions included educational booklets, presentations, and personal biomarker feedback.
- Pre- and post-intervention measurements of airborne dust and nickel, along with blood and urine nickel concentrations.
Main Results:
- No significant difference was observed in airborne nickel or dust concentrations before and after interventions.
- Significant reductions in post-intervention urinary and blood nickel concentrations were observed across all groups.
- Median urinary nickel decreased from 43.2–57.4 µg/L to 8.5–9.6 µg/L, and serum nickel from 1.7–2.0 µg/L to 0.1 µg/L post-intervention.
Conclusions:
- Educational interventions, particularly those incorporating personal feedback, can significantly reduce personal nickel exposure in smelter workers.
- Changes in personal hygiene behavior are key to reducing internal nickel exposure, as indicated by biomarker levels.
- Targeted educational strategies are effective in mitigating occupational health risks associated with nickel exposure.

Precipitation gravimetry is based on converting an analyte into a sparingly soluble precipitate, which is separated by filtration and weighed. An ideal precipitate should be pure, insoluble, of known composition, and easily filtered from the reaction mixture.

Operant conditioning serves as a foundational principle in therapeutic interventions aimed at modifying maladaptive behaviors. Central to this approach is the notion that behaviors, both adaptive and maladaptive, are learned through reinforcement. By analyzing the environmental factors that reinforce problematic behaviors, clinicians can design interventions to weaken these reinforcements and replace maladaptive behaviors with healthier alternatives.
